The decision to charge entry fee at the Naroda Lake has left the Congress in the Ahmedabad Municipal Corporation (AMC) fuming.

The Opposition party has termed the move as cruel. Leader of Opposition in the AMC Surendra Baxi and former mayor Himmatsinh Patel in a statement said that AMC should not make open recreational spaces a means to earn money.

"The civic body's move to come up with more recreational space for citizens is laudable. There is a dearth of public space in the city and so implementing entry fee at such lakes especially in an area inhabited by middle class is not a good idea," said Baxi.
